Haiti Flag Flag Information two equal horizontal bands of blue (top) and red with a centered white rectangle bearing the coat of arms, which contains a palm tree flanked by flags and two cannons above a scroll bearing the motto L'UNION FAIT LA FORCE (Union Makes Strength) the colors are taken from the French Tricolor and represent the union of blacks and mulattoes
Source: CIA - The World Factbook
